Thanks partially to its damp weather, ideal for increasing sheep, Britain had a long history of manufacturing textiles like wool, linen and cotton.

Starting off while in the mid-18th century, innovations such as spinning jenny (a picket frame with numerous spindles), the flying shuttle, the water body and the ability loom produced weaving cloth and spinning yarn and thread a lot easier. Manufacturing cloth became a lot quicker and expected considerably less time and far fewer human labor.

The beginning of industrialization in The us is generally pegged to the opening of the textile mill in Pawtucket, Rhode Island, in 1793 because of the new English immigrant Samuel Slater. Slater experienced worked at among the mills opened by Richard Arkwright (inventor of the water body) mills, and Irrespective of rules prohibiting the emigration of textile employees, he brought Arkwright’s layouts over the Atlantic.
